Art Conservation Career Roles

Art Conservator: Responsible for the preservation and restoration of art objects, ensuring they remain in good condition for future generations.
Preservation Specialist: Focuses on the long-term care of art collections, implementing strategies to protect artworks from deterioration.
Restoration Technician: Works hands-on to restore artworks to their original condition, utilizing various restoration methods and techniques.
Conservation Scientist: Applies scientific principles to analyze materials and techniques used in artworks, aiding in preservation efforts.
Collections Manager: Oversees art collections, ensuring proper documentation, storage, and maintenance of art pieces in galleries or museums.
Art Historian: Researches and interprets the historical context of artworks, contributing to conservation strategies based on historical significance.
Curatorial Assistant: Supports curators in managing exhibitions and collections, helping to preserve and interpret artworks for public display.
